
Full-Stack Product Engineer - Agentic First
WonderdogWonder Dog is a preventative health platform for dogs. We send licensed vet techs to your home for a blood draw, run a 40+ biomarker panel through a national lab, and turn the results into something owners can actually act on. We're a small team with paying customers, and you'd be working directly with the founder and our lead engineer.
How we work
AI coding agents do most of the typing here. Your job is to direct them, review the output, and make sure what ships is right. You pick up a ticket, ship it, verify it, and move on. Few meetings, no ceremony.
What you'll do
- Ship customer-facing features end to end: UI, API, database
- Work a prioritized backlog across checkout, booking, onboarding, and mobile
- Own quality. If it's not tested and working, it's not done
- Tell us when we're wrong. We'd rather hear it early
You're probably a fit if
- You've shipped full-stack TypeScript products that people paid for
- AI agents are already how you work, not something you're curious about
- You like autonomy and hate process for its own sake
